Market Overview
The global AI Studio market is witnessing robust
expansion as businesses seek faster, more efficient, and user-friendly ways to
develop AI applications. Traditional AI development cycles often span months,
requiring coordination among data engineers, data scientists, and developers.
AI Studios simplify this process through graphical user interfaces (GUIs),
pre-built algorithms, data connectors, and model lifecycle management tools.
These platforms are available both as cloud-based SaaS
offerings and on-premises enterprise solutions, allowing flexibility
depending on data privacy and compliance needs. AI Studios are being widely
adopted in healthcare, retail, finance, manufacturing, marketing, and
logistics, enabling companies to create predictive analytics models,
chatbots, fraud detection systems, and personalized recommendation engines
without starting from scratch.

Technological Innovations in the AI Studio Market
1. Low-Code/No-Code AI Development
Modern AI Studios prioritize low-code or no-code
environments that enable users to visually design workflows. Through
pre-trained models, automated hyperparameter tuning, and simplified data
pipelines, users can quickly build applications without coding expertise. This
trend is reshaping the talent landscape, allowing business analysts and domain
experts to become “citizen data scientists.”
2. AutoML (Automated Machine Learning)
AI Studios are increasingly adopting AutoML technologies,
which automatically handle data preprocessing, feature engineering, model
selection, and evaluation. AutoML significantly reduces the time required to
develop accurate models, ensuring that organizations can deploy AI solutions
faster and more efficiently.
3. Integration of Large Language Models (LLMs)
With the rise of LLMs like GPT, Claude, and Gemini,
AI Studios are embedding these powerful engines into their ecosystems. This
integration allows users to fine-tune models for specific use cases — such as
summarization, question-answering, and contextual search — without requiring
massive data infrastructure investments.
4. Multi-Modal AI Development
The next wave of AI Studios is focusing on multi-modal
capabilities, combining text, audio, images, and video data into unified AI
models. This enables more advanced applications such as video analytics,
real-time emotion detection, and interactive AI assistants that understand
multiple forms of input.
5. AI Governance and Responsible AI
With growing concerns about bias, transparency, and
compliance, AI Studios are incorporating ethical AI frameworks that help
track data lineage, model decisions, and algorithmic fairness. Responsible AI
features allow organizations to build trust while meeting regulatory standards
like GDPR and AI Act compliance.

Challenges and Restraints
Despite its enormous potential, the AI Studio market faces
several challenges:
- Data
Quality and Availability: AI models rely on high-quality data. Many
organizations struggle with fragmented or unstructured datasets, affecting
model performance.
- High
Computational Costs: Training complex AI models requires significant
processing power, making scalability a challenge for small and mid-sized
enterprises.
- Skill
Gaps: While AI Studios simplify model creation, interpreting outputs
and ensuring responsible usage still require expertise.
- Data
Privacy and Security: As data flows across cloud environments,
ensuring compliance with regional privacy laws remains a critical issue.
- Vendor
Lock-In: Enterprises must navigate the risk of becoming dependent on a
single AI Studio vendor’s ecosystem.
Addressing these issues through open standards, transparent
pricing, and robust AI governance frameworks will be crucial for sustainable
market growth.
